Description

P{EP} element insertion approximately 3kb upstream of the nej open reading frame, in the 5' UTR. The orientation of the P{EP} element is such that the 3' end of the P{EP} element is proximal to the nej open reading frame, allowing overexpression of nej under the control of the Scer\UAS regulatory sequences present in the P{EP} element.

Phenotypic Data
Phenotypic Class
Phenotype Manifest In
Detailed Description
Statement
Reference

Third instar larvae expressing nejEP1149 under the control of Scer\GAL4Pxn.PS have a decreased number of sessile hemocytes. The number of hemocytes in circulation is also decreased. The dorsal sessile hemocyte department is disrupted. Sessile hemocytes accumulate along the dorsal vessel but do not spread through the cuticle. The lymph gland is enlarged. Most hemocytes appear wild type in shape, although a few larger cells can also be detected.

Expression of nejEP1149 under the control of Scer\GAL4GMR.PF results in a small eye phenotype.

Expression of CG15321EP1149 under the control of Scer\GAL4ey.PH results in eyes that are strongly reduced in size.

Expression of nejEP1149 under the control of Scer\GAL4sca-537.4 results in potential socket-to-shaft and shaft-to-socket transformations, severe loss of scutellar and dorsocentral macrochaetae, short and thickened shaft morphology and sockets with shaft-like protrusions.

nejEP1149/nejTA57 or nejEP1149/nejS342 transheterozygotes are semi-viable as third instar larvae. These larvae are developmentally delayed by approximately 1 day and are sluggish. Homozygous larvae show a significant decrease in presynaptic transmitter release (quantal content) without any change in quantal size at the neuromuscular junction. No change in the average muscle resting potential or in the average muscle input resistance is seen. Synaptic ultrastructure at neuromuscular boutons appears normal. There is an increase in the number of presynaptic T bars per active zone compared to wild type. Overexpression of nejEP1149 under the control of Scer\GAL4elav.PLu results in early larval lethality. Overexpression of nejEP1149 under the control of Scer\GAL4elav.PLu (in nejEP1149 heterozygotes) results in a decrease in presynaptic transmitter release at the neuromuscular junction, without any change quantal size. There is a significant (although moderate) increase in the number of boutons at the neuromuscular junction of muscles 4, 6 and 7 compared to wild type in nejEP1149/nejS342, nejEP1149/nejQ7 or nejEP1149/nejTA57 larvae. No alteration in axon guidance in the embryonic central nervous system is seen.

Additional Comments
Genetic Interactions
Statement
Reference

Co-expression of CycEScer\UAS.cLa does not suppress the small eye phenotype caused by expression of CG15321EP1149 under the control of Scer\GAL4ey.PH.

Complementation and Rescue Data
Comments

nejEP1149 fails to complement nejTA57 and nejS342 for synaptic transmission defects. The synaptic defects seen at the neuromuscular junction in hemizygous nejEP1149 larvae are rescued when nejEP1149 is overexpressed using Scer\GAL4Mhc.PW.
